    About this experience

    If you are intrigued by Amsterdam's Red Light District, this soundwalk will help you learn about its realities and legends. On this self-guided tour, you'll get commentary on Amsterdam's history, revealing the stories behind the creation of this controversial neighborhood. The tour begins at the Basilica of St. Nicholas. Then you will discover interesting places of interest, among them, the Erotic Museum and the Marijuana and Hemp Museum, opened in 1885. • It allows you to go as per your own convenience of time, pace and locations • A sensory experience with 3D sounds and creative scripts • The audio guides can be listened to online or offline in our app • If you have any questions about any attractions, No worries we will answer instantly by message
